Output 705e95af2a8ffe4e16b671caa694dd95a8d962de9e27414577396fc9ad07e51a:1

value
350894
script pubkey
OP_0 OP_PUSHBYTES_20 db619b24d174210f28fc366317eefde650a13334
address
bc1qmdsekfx3wsss728uxe330mhaueg2zve59kagg0
transaction
705e95af2a8ffe4e16b671caa694dd95a8d962de9e27414577396fc9ad07e51a
confirmations
16430
spent
true